Clean Energy Is the S&P 500’s New Boss: ACES Up 29% YTD

The ALPS Clean Energy ETF (ACES) has significantly outperformed the S&P 500 year-to-date, despite a recent 9% single-day drop, driven by macro tailwinds like increased data center electricity demand and utility infrastructure upgrades. However, a critical deadline on June 30, 2026, for clean energy tax credits under the OBBBA poses a significant policy risk to about 22% of ACES's assets, particularly for companies reliant on consumer subsidies for residential solar and EVs. Investors are advised to monitor the outcome of this policy decision, lithium prices, and utility capital expenditure guidance as these factors will heavily influence the fund's future performance.
